+ + + Company News + + + News + + + International Events + IDS Expands International Business - New Partners in Central Europe
With a staff of eighteen specialists, TDC in Prague provides a broad experience and know-how for the implementation of water projects. Since 1994, TDC has supplied control systems to the Prague waterworks; since 1993, TDC has delivered a flood monitoring system for the Eger river and its tributaries. With a staff of thirteen employees, TDS in Ostrava is particularly active in the gas supply area; they have designed and delivered the control system for the regional gas utilities in Southern Moravia. Apart from expanding the market, the acquisition of TDC and TDS is part of a wider strategy: TDC produces small-range control systems which could be a suitable complement of the IDS range of products. The product developers from TDC and IDS have already met for discussing the possibilities in that area. "With our IDS branch in Bratislava, our new Czech partners, as well as Microtech International Ltd., our VAR partner in Poland, we are ready for an expansion of our business in Eastern Europe", says Norbert Wagner, Director of the International Energy Division of IDS Ettlingen. He expects that the close cooperation between TDS, TDC and IDS Bratislava, who have been operating on the Czech/Slovak market for ten years, will establish a solid foundation for IDS's future success in the business.
